Overview
Represents a time of day. The date and time zone are either not significant or
are specified elsewhere. An API may choose to allow leap seconds. Related
types are google.type.Date and google.protobuf.Timestamp.

Instance Attribute Details
#hours ⇒ Fixnum
Hours of day in 24 hour format. Should be from 0 to 23. An API may choose to
allow the value "24:00:00" for scenarios like business closing time.
Corresponds to the JSON property hours
1892 1893 1894 |
# File 'lib/google/apis/managedidentities_v1/classes.rb', line 1892 def hours @hours end |
#minutes ⇒ Fixnum
Minutes of hour of day. Must be from 0 to 59.
Corresponds to the JSON property minutes
1897 1898 1899 |
# File 'lib/google/apis/managedidentities_v1/classes.rb', line 1897 def minutes @minutes end |
#nanos ⇒ Fixnum
Fractions of seconds in nanoseconds. Must be from 0 to 999,999,999.
Corresponds to the JSON property nanos
1902 1903 1904 |
# File 'lib/google/apis/managedidentities_v1/classes.rb', line 1902 def nanos @nanos end |
#seconds ⇒ Fixnum
Seconds of minutes of the time. Must normally be from 0 to 59. An API may
allow the value 60 if it allows leap-seconds.
Corresponds to the JSON property seconds
